Spring MVCを使用するアプリケーションでログを記録するためのベスト プラクティスを見つけようとしています。ベストプラクティスを理解し、理解するのを手伝っていただければ幸いです。
今のところ、アプリケーションにロギングを実装するための 2 つの選択肢があります。
Log4J ロギング (非 AOP 固有の伝統的なアプローチ)
AOP ベースのロギング
それぞれの選択肢の利点を考慮して、どのアプローチを選択すべきかを理解できる回答をいただければ幸いです。
Spring MVCを使用するアプリケーションでログを記録するためのベスト プラクティスを見つけようとしています。ベストプラクティスを理解し、理解するのを手伝っていただければ幸いです。
今のところ、アプリケーションにロギングを実装するための 2 つの選択肢があります。
Log4J ロギング (非 AOP 固有の伝統的なアプローチ)
AOP ベースのロギング
それぞれの選択肢の利点を考慮して、どのアプローチを選択すべきかを理解できる回答をいただければ幸いです。
Log4J は、log4j.properties を提供することで優れた柔軟性を提供します。ここで、関心のあるロギングのレベルを構成できます。Log4J ロギングの使用をお勧めします。
これは、 Log4Jのログ レベルを詳細に説明する適切な参照ポイントです。